I've usually check it once a year. I get my annual free credit report and that's how I check it out. It's a way for me to keep a somewhat close eye on my credit but not checking all the time. Did you know you can check it free once a year no credit card required at www.annualcreditreport.com? And just in case you can use a debit card on other legit sites.
